Greenwood Sustainable Infrastructure LLC (GSI), one of the renewable energy subsidiaries of Libra Group, has announced that Iyuh\u00e1na Solar (Iyuh\u00e1na), a GSI-led partnership with Saturn Power Inc. and Ocean Man First Nation, has been awarded a Power Purchase Agreement (PPA) to construct and operate the facility. Once in operation, the project will be one of Canada\u2019s 10 largest solar facilities.<\/p>\n<p>Under an exclusive PPA, the largest with a utility in Canada since 2015, Iyuh\u00e1na plans to invest approximately $200 million to construct the solar facility, which it will operate, supplying generated power to the principal municipal utility company, SaskPower, for 25 years. Located in the Rural Municipality of Estevan in southeast Saskatchewan, the emissions-free solar facility will produce enough power for the equivalent of approximately 25,000 homes.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We are proud to bring the transformative power of solar energy to Saskatchewan by working with partners such as Ocean Man First Nation,\u201d said Mazen Turk, CEO of GSI. \u201cThis unique collaboration shows the power of renewable energy to harness resources and empower communities responsibly. This work is core to our ethos as a Libra company, and we look forward to continuing to help support a clean energy future across Canada and beyond.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>As a founding partner, Ocean Man First Nation will have an ownership stake in Iyuh\u00e1na Solar. Band members will also receive specialized training to maintain the solar facilities and employment opportunities with the project. Additionally, partnering with two of Saskatchewan\u2019s leading post-secondary academic institutions, Iyuh\u00e1na will provide scholarships, internships, and direct research projects in clean energy to benefit the community.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cOur partnership with GSI and SaskPower will bring great opportunities for Ocean Man First Nation, including employment and revenue that will provide stability and sustainability for our Band,\u201d said Chief Connie Big Eagle, Ocean Man First Nation. \u201cWe are proud that this project, which is able to generate clean power, will be known as Iyuh\u00e1na Solar, which, in Nakotah translates to \u2018everyone\u2019 or \u2018all of us.\u2019 This is derived from our Nakotah belief that everyone and everything is related and therefore we must care for each other.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>While investment in renewable energy grows across Canada, Saskatchewan\u2019s clean power supply mix has predominantly consisted of hydro and wind.
